Service Description: This project is for provision of Airborne LiDAR survey over 311 km2 at Tauranga and McLaren Falls, in the Bay of Plenty. This dataset is part of the BOPLASS capture programme for 2022-2023.
Capture was completed between 2nd and 3rd of December 2022.
The survey was planned to achieve +/-10cm vertical accuracy (RMS), +/- 30cm horizontal accuracy (RMS) with an emitted pulse density of 8ppsm. Ground classification to ICSM level 2.
